Meredith MacRae actress, television personality and daughter of the late singer and actor Gordon MacRae shook the long, blond hair away from her face Friday, straightened the jacket of her Christmas-red, wasp-waist suit and told an audience of counselors and business representatives about the men who have rejected her. MacRae was speaking to a group of employers and counselors attending a luncheon in honor of the 10th anniversary of the forming of St. Anthony Hospital's CareUnit, which treats patients with drug and alcohol dependence, as well as other members of dysfunctional families. Meredith Lynn MacRae (May 30, 1944 - July 14, 2000) [1] was an American actress, singer and talk show host. In 1966, MacRae signed a contract with CBS to play Billie Jo Bradley on the sitcom Petticoat Junction, starring Bea Benaderet as her television mother and Edgar Buchanan as her television uncle.
